Is Björk the last great pop innovator?

Simon Reynolds, The Guardian, 4 July 2011

EARLIER THIS YEAR I interviewed Amanda Brown of cult band LA Vampires and was surprised when she announced that "every day I wake up and ask myself: 'How I can be more like Björk?' How can I be the most ecstatic, eclectic artist?" Surprised because Björk had dipped out of view in recent years and I confess that I'd half-forgotten how interesting she was as an artist – and just how long she'd stayed interesting.
